Managed to have a look inside the hive about two weeks ago, bees seemed plentiful, 5-6 frames of brood, added a super and the QE, didnt do too much weather was only just warm enough to risk a look. Since then I havent been able to check again due to weather.
Today my daughter called me to say bees were carrying bees off, sounded strange so went home to have alook, and sure enough, every few minutes two (or three) bees would fly apparently joined together. there were also about a dozen dead bees on the landing board. Did manage to get a close up of the combatants and they were both black bees My only conclusion was that the hive was being robbed and the bees were joined together by a sting as the robber flew off. Does this sound right ? From the books it seems bees usually rob weaker hives so is it likely that mine have swarmed and I have missed it, there has been no recent activty to spill honey or syrup anywhere near the hive to attract robbers
